Born November 5, 1934 in Lenoir County, NC, she was the daughter of the late Cora Belle and William Andrew Emory.
Raised in Kinston, NC, she subsequently relocated many times up and down the east coast until her husband's retirement from the United States Marine Corps In 1978. They then selected Columbus County, NC to be their final resting place.
She worked many years at the Kinston Shirt Factory – as did her mother before her and her daughter after her. In retirement, her passions became her grandchildren's sporting events and her yard work. She rarely missed a ball game and devoted countless hours to adorning her yard with a abundance of blooms for all who passed by to enjoy. She was a devoted member of Western Prong Baptist Church, spending most Sundays in the nursery enjoying the company of children who are likely now young adults.
